Soft, Breathable Fabric
The quality of fabric determines how comfortable your daughter’s underwear will be. As you may already know, there are literally a myriad of different materials and fabrics used in the textile industry. However, not all of them are suited for your preteen.
For example, if your kid is showing the first signs of puberty, chances are that she’ll have sensitive skin, extensive sweating, and body acne, aside from hair growth.
That said, fabrics such as cotton, bamboo, and modal are extremely soft, breathable, and moisture-wicking, which means underwear made from these materials is ideal for preteens going through puberty.

Proper Sizing
Kids grow fast, faster than we realize. One day, your daughter is just a kid; the next, she needs a bra, go figure. Buying underwear for kids who are growing seems like an uphill battle.
Well, all you can do is be tactical about it. For example, opting for adjustable padded bras means that you won’t have to replace them as soon as your kid grows an inch or two.
Sizes like 8/10 mean that the pair of underwear is designed to fit girls between the sizes of eight and ten. In other words, you’re good for a longer while.
Added Comfort
Attention to detail is what makes preteen girls’ underwear stand out from the rest. Most manufacturers know that young girls who are about to enter puberty or have already entered it can be extremely sensitive to any stimuli.
To make things easier for them, many brands have removed seams, labels, and other details that can further irritate the skin or make girls uncomfortable. This type of attention to detail is what you should look for in a pair of preteen undies.

Briefs Underwear
Briefs are an embodiment of comfort in the world of undies. They are practical, offer good coverage, and can fit well under basically any outfit. They are simply perfect for preteens due to the fact that most undies are made out of natural fibers such as cotton or modal.
As you may already know, organic cotton is very soft, extremely durable, and one of the best moisture-wicking fabrics in the world.
As far as style goes, briefs slightly resemble the good-old tighty-whities or granny panties, which might indicate that your daughter may not find them appealing.
However, the style of modern briefs for young girls has been perfected over the years, and there are adorable pieces that even the pickiest of girls couldn’t say no to.
Key Features:
-
Cotton briefs are perfect for sensitive skin, due to the hypoallergenic properties of cotton.
-
Briefs are designed to provide comfort above all else, which is why there are seamless models with no labels or accessories whatsoever.
-
Extended coverage is great for shy girls, and the extra fabric is excellent for fitting in pads if your daughter is on her first period.
Bikinis
Bikini undies are probably the most sought-after model among preteen and teenage girls. These panties are very stylish, but at the same time, they also offer modest coverage.
Unlike briefs, bikinis have higher leg-cut openings, wider side cuts, and a lower waistband. In other words, they are more flexible and liberating in terms of movement.
Key Features:
-
Very stylish undergarments that come in various sizes, colors, and styles.
-
Often made from different fabrics or blended materials, so keep an eye out if your daughter has any allergies to specific materials.
-
Although a bit daring, bikinis offer a great boost in confidence and self-esteem. They can be worn for any occasion and fit well under anything your daughter has in her wardrobe.
Boyshorts
Inspired by the boxers boys often wear, boyshorts are the girl variant of boxers, redesigned to suit the needs of your preteen.
In terms of coverage, boyshorts cover everything and ensure everything stays where it should be. This makes them ideal undies for active girls who are into sports or any other kind of physical activity.
Key Features:
-
Very snug, very fitting, so that they can be easily worn under skirts or school uniforms.
-
Not ideal for everyday wear, a lot of coverage can feel overwhelming, even though most boyshorts are made out of breathable materials.
-
Boyshorts can contain spandex and elastane, which makes them more snug. And even if your daughter has sensitive skin, boyshorts will offer just a touch of stretch, which makes them the perfect choice.
Hipsters
Hipsters combine the best both briefs and bikinis have to offer. They are a perfect blend of the two, providing comfort and coverage while also providing style and flexibility.
They fit perfectly on the hips, hence the name. Among all panty models, hipsters are the most versatile.
Key Features:
-
Hipsters come in various styles, such as casual, lacework, no panty line or seamless, and printed with unique patterns, aside from a plethora of colors.
-
Hipster panties are designed to accommodate any body type, which is why you can opt for high-waist, mid-waist, or low-waist hipsters with either full or medium coverage.
-
Hipsters are made from various fabrics, so again, keep that in mind if your daughter has sensitive skin or allergic reactions to specific materials.

For example, if you’re already looking for undies, why not look for a matching bra, as well? A nice training bra will really complement whatever your daughter decides to buy. But, hold on, when do girls start wearing training bras?
Well, although not necessary, it’s preferable for girls to start wearing one as soon as they start to develop. That said, thelarche, also known as breast budding, is one of the first signs of pubertal development.
Wearing a training bra is ideal in such situations. The main reason is that training bras offer slight support with no underwires or paddings. They are simply comfortable, cute tops that go very well with any type of undies.
While you’re at it, it’s always a good idea to keep an eye out for fabrics and materials. Preteens who will soon enter puberty, if they haven’t done so already, require gentle materials so that their skin isn’t irritated further. Here are a few examples of different fabrics that are perfect for preteen underwear.
-
Cotton - Extremely durable, soft, breathable, and moisture-wicking.
-
Bamboo - More moisture-wicking and softer than cotton. However, it tends to lose shape after a number of washes.
-
Modal - Better than any other fabric regarding softness, breathability, and moisture-wicking. Unfortunately, it’s more expensive than the rest.
-
Silk - Very smooth, very comfortable, and most importantly, very delicate. But, like modal, silk undies are expensive.

What size underwear does a 12-year-old wear?
That entirely depends on specific measurements like hip size, waist size, height, and weight. What’s more, different apparel brands have different measurement charts, so you really need to look at those and compare them. In most cases, those size charts vary slightly, but differ nonetheless. So, for example, if your 12-year-old is size 10 at one brand, she may be size 11 at the other.
